If you are using MM2 to make you movie then when you come to save it,
instead of choosing best for computer playback choose
"Show more choices"
and pick dv-avi from the list.
This will give you the avi file to make your vcd.
Oooops, you say you are saving using media player. Do a google search for
".wmv to .avi" you should find some free apps to do it, use one of these and
then make your vcd.
